Chlorophytum acclimatization timeThe length of time it takes for spider plants to acclimate after being potted mainly depends on the environment in which they are kept during the acclimatization period. If, after repotting, it is placed in an environment of about 20°C with scattered light, it will acclimate smoothly in about 5-7 days. However, if the maintenance environment is not good, it may take 15-20 days or even longer to acclimate. Acclimation performance : You can gently push the spider plant to see if it can be moved. If not, it means it has adapted to the pot. You can also observe its growth. If it grows taller or crooked, it is also a sign of acclimation. How to make spider plants adapt to the pot quicklyWhen repotting, you should prepare a pot that is one size larger than the original one so that the roots of the spider plant can breathe better. It is also best to disinfect and sterilize the pot. After repotting, it needs to be placed in a well-ventilated, scattered light area for maintenance and should not be exposed directly to the sun. Chlorophytum maintenance during the acclimatization period1. During the acclimatization period of the spider plant, you should pay attention to the maintenance methods. Don't rush to expose it to the sun. It doesn't need to be watered frequently at this time, and you don't need to apply fertilizer. It should be placed in a place with scattered light and ventilation. It does not need to be watered if the soil is slightly moist. It should be allowed to acclimate for a week before applying fertilizer. When the growth resumes, you can manage it normally. 2. If the soil in the pot is relatively soft and moist, it is recommended not to water it. Wait until the soil in the pot is a little drier before watering it to allow the roots of the spider plant time to heal themselves. When the roots are injured, a lot of watering will delay the progress of the spider plant and prolong the time it takes to heal. 3. After repotting the spider plant, you must not apply fertilizer. You must wait until it resumes normal growth and follow the principle of "applying small amounts of fertilizer frequently" to fertilize it. 4. When the spider plant is repotted, the root system is damaged and the water absorption is reduced. At this time, sun exposure will increase the evaporation of water from the leaves, and the water absorbed by the roots cannot be provided to the leaves in time, causing the leaves to lose water and become soft, which can severely cause the death of the spider plant. Usually, the newly transplanted spider plant should be placed in a sunny and ventilated place indoors to facilitate its recovery and growth. |
